Just wondering what would be a better chassis for autoX. A soft flexible chassis or one that is more solid.

I'm guessing that a soft chassis will generally have more bite, but that it may not transition as well.

Or is this just driver preference?

A hard chassis is going to have to have grip to "work". Autocross courses are typically quite green since they're all temporary circuits, and usually QUITE dusty for most of the day. Even Nationals doesn't have the rubber build-up that a kart track will have at the end of the weekend. For that reason, I'd tend to say that a softer chassis is going to work better. I think that several manufacturers are moving toward harder chassis, though, as more shifter tracks (and big-name series) come along.
